Carsten Haitzler (The Rasterman) wrote:
(B> hmm - i'm not sure about ewl - that's nathan and atmos's big baby - i
(B> personally
(B> think it'd be good for ewl to provide an explicit api... you could also use
(B> the
(B> ewl_embed that means you create the evas yourself with ecore_evas and then
(B> just
(B> tell ewl to use it. then you will have full control.
(B
(BI'm always in favour of explicit APIs! When documentation is thin or
(Binterfaces are in flux, then looking at a simple C header can speed up
(Bthe learning curve no end. This has been really handy when learning to
(Buse Ecore and Evas.
(B
(BThat said, I'm impressed how easy it has been to get started with EWL
(B(once I got through my initial fumbling!). Congratulations guys!
(B
(B>>Also, what is the file format for ecore_config databases? The EFL
(B>>cookbook says it is EDB, but ecore_config looks for EETs. In fact, by
(B>>my reading of the code, the following should work to create a config.eet
(B>>file:
(B>
(B>
(B> yeah. it's wrong. i moved it to eet to make it more efficient for config file
(B> size etc.
(B>
(B>
(B>># echo -en "str\0fb\0" >ewl/evas/render_method
(B>># eet -c config.eet ewl
(B>
(B>
(B> no no :) eet is just a test/debug tool. not intended for creating/editing
(B> eet's.
(B> eet's are really only editable via the api in c. u'd make a tool to do it. you
(B> could only create eet's via ecore_config's api. the api will define what
(B> defaults are and so ecore_config will end up writing that out. it'd be
(B> possible
(B> to make a quick tool to generate/modify these files though using the api's :)
(B
(BShall I take the bait? (ponders...)
(B
(B--
(BSimon Poole
(Bwww.appliancestudio.com
(B
(B
(B
(B-------------------------------------------------------
(BThis SF.Net email is sponsored by Yahoo.
(BIntroducing Yahoo! Search Developer Network - Create apps using Yahoo!
(BSearch APIs Find out how you can build Yahoo! directly into your own
(BApplications - visit http://developer.yahoo.net/?fr=offad-ysdn-ostg-q22005
(B_______________________________________________
(Benlightenment-devel mailing list
([email protected]
(Bhttps://lists.sourceforge.net/lists/listinfo/enlightenment-devel